Toyota GT86 Price & Specs – starts at £24,995
Fri, 30 Mar 2012Toyota GT86 Price & Spec The Toyota GT86 will cost from £24,995 in the UK and will come in a single spec. GT 86 with auto ‘box will cost £26,495. We already know that the Toyota GT86 will cost £24,995, because Toyota told us so last month.
Geely at Shanghai 2011: Geely MINI Cooper & Geely London Taxi
Tue, 26 Apr 2011Geely's take on the London Cab & MINI Cooper Regular readers – in fact anyone who takes notice of car news – will probably recognise Geely as being the Chinese car maker who bought Volvo in 2010. Proper car anoraks may also remember the ‘Chinese Rolls Royce‘, a Phantom ‘Homage’ from Geely that came equipped with a ‘Throne’ in the back to transport a lone plutocrat. It looked a lot like a Russian cold war ZIL meets cartoon Phantom and there was no mistaking it was a Chinese car for a Chinese market.
